It has nothing to do with the FMIC. After sitting...
It has nothing to do with the FMIC. After sitting for a certain amount of time the fuel system will lose prime, if it sits long enough the car will prime the system when you hit unlock on the key fob...

Sticky: You only want the wastegates closed during spool...
You only want the wastegates closed during spool up, once you hit requested boost the DME will then begin PWM the WGs to maintain boost.
